As we reached Baga beach immediately started getting deals for water sports. After bargaining for next
15 minutes we reached a price of Rs 2600 for four of us which will include 3 things i.e. Banana Ride, Jet
Ski and Parasailing. Since we had to be in water for next couple of hours there were not many
photographs clicked. Although we did shoot a video for Parasailing by my cousins digi-cam right now it’s
with him. After having loads of fun especially in banana ride where they make you fall right into sea with
ofcourse life jacket on. My wife really got scared with the act and was almost not ready to leave my hand.
But with life jacket on in water you are not allowed to hold other untill it is really neccessary. After getting
the senses, we asked boat guy to pull her up first and in the process she almost drowned him He was
like swimming beneath her body and as she was just floating with the current he couldn’t manage to
come aside and up. Finally he managed to do so and screamed "Madam aap to mujhe maar hi daalti"
(Madam you would have certainly killed me). But the whole ride was just super duperfun:D…
Now it was the turn of JetSki which I didn’t enjoyed too much. It was pretty OK to say atleast. Now the
turn was for the big one "Parasailing". Well we signed the document stating our declaration, consent and
responsibility of anything happening to us. Then we got on the boat which took us to the main streamer
where parasailing actually takes place. In the streamer a family was there with 2 very small kids, I beleive
4-5 years max. They were like jumping to get their turn to fly :), amazing to see that. Slowly we went on
flying for next 3-4 minutes and it was a wonderful feeling. Well the most difficult part is to move from one
boat to the streamer and then back again after you are done.

We saw the market getting open on the way towards Anjuna and reached Paradiso around 7.30 PM. We
confirmed from the manager named Raj and he said party is tonight starting in next 1.30 Hrs till 6.00 AM
morning. It was like change of plans for us as we were expecting it tommorrow. Nevermind we bought the
passes for Paradiso club which usually priced at Rs 1000 per couple with unlimited alcoholic drinks :D.
That night they had altered it to Rs 500 per couple excluding the drinks but drinks were priced not like any
bar in NCR. They were cheap like Rs 80/100 for 60 ml shot of Vodka(Romanov/Smirnoff) and beer was
like Rs 50.

Well as said Ingo Saturday night market was upto the expectations in terms of babes and live music. Well
it is refered as World’s Local Market but ofcourse not for shopping. You can find everything what is sold in
that World’s Local Market in Delhi at Janapath or Sarojini Nagar but butbut BABES no way. Although
you need to pay alot more than Delhi since the seller is non-indian I feel :). It was like one of the places in
Goa where you can find foreigners getting dressed up to something, everywhere else you only find very
little to be named as clothes on them. Here is my try for the night photography very first time.
